Ultra LEDs has supplied professional lighting across the UK for more than fifteen years. The company works with architects, retailers, and installers. It designs complete LED systems that are both creative and reliable. The range includes flexible strips, profiles, drivers, controllers, and neon flex lighting for indoor and outdoor projects.
Based in Manchester in a 17,000 sq ft facility, Ultra LEDs serves a wide range of professional sectors. These include construction, events, manufacturing, signage, and theatre. The company is known for its technical expertise, fast delivery, and reliable customer support. Ultra LEDs delivered lighting for big UK projects. These included the Hublot x Premier League launch, Love Island All Stars 2025, and the Science Museum exhibition “Voyage to the Edge of Imagination.” It used custom RGB systems, neon flex, and LED tapes to create vivid, immersive lighting for each project.
Goals for Lighting Visualization
The goal was to showcase sophisticated lighting solutions aimed at professionals. This meant focusing on the following objectives.
- Presenting complex product designs with clarity. We used cross-section renders to show internal components and details.
- Showing product variations and configurations in a comparable way. We used a controlled render setup. Each image followed the same angle and environment to keep the look consistent.
- Maintaining a cohesive look across the imagery. The team used balanced lighting, uniform color grading, and identical framing for all the renders.
- Showing light behavior. Diffusion, glow, and color accuracy are highly important for a lighting product. We conveyed them through 3D product close-ups and lighting demo renders.
- Illustrating how products fit into real spaces. The focus was on light quality and atmosphere. We used office lifestyle renders for that purpose.

3D Renderings for Lighting PCBs
These close-up 3D renderings show the printed circuit boards used in LED strips. Each render highlights the layout of diodes, resistors, and solder pads. The 3D visuals help reveal how every strip is built and how it bends without breaking the circuit. They show the product’s precise engineering and solid build quality in a simple, clear way.



Finish and Lighting State Renders
This set focuses on the visual range of the LED neon strip. It appears lit in multiple color options and unlit to reveal the surface texture and finish. The goal is to show how one product can shift from a vivid glow to a calm, decorative element depending on use and environment.












Product Behavior 3D Renderings
In this series, attention shifts to how the LED neon strip behaves once shaped by hand. The product is shown in movement rather than at rest, bending into smooth lines and wide arcs. Light stays steady even when the strip curves sharply, which speaks to its build quality. The visuals give a tactile sense of how flexible materials respond in practical design use.

Installation and Application Renderings
These 3D renders detail how the LED neon strip adheres to a flat surface using its 3M adhesive backing. The set pairs silo shots with a shelf installation view. This way, the user can clearly see the connection between product form and final use. The images emphasize bend precision, adhesive coverage, and consistent light across curves. Both silo renderings and the close-up serve as reliable visual references for mounting quality and lighting behavior.

3D Rendering for LED strips and Other Lighting Fixtures
Brands use photorealistic product rendering to plan how a design will look before production. Marketing teams can present new models early, test ideas, and launch campaigns without waiting for manufacturing. The process saves weeks of work and removes prototype costs. Also, the images are easy to repurpose for any campaign or platform. Each 3D asset can be reused across a full content plan. It adapts to lifestyle scenes, product cutouts, and every color option while keeping lighting and angles identical. This consistency builds a strong, recognizable style across websites and catalogs. When designs change, the model updates instantly. New renders are ready within hours for online stores, ads, or videos. The workflow gives teams both speed and creative freedom while ensuring every image stays clear, precise, and brand-ready.
